Anxiety, attention and pain

A Arntz1, P de Jong

  • 1Department of Medical Psychology, Limburg University, Maastricht, The Netherlands.

Journal of Psychosomatic Research
|May 1, 1993
PubMed
Summary

Focusing attention away from pain, not anxiety levels, significantly reduces subjective pain perception. This finding highlights the role of attentional focus in pain modulation for individuals with phobias.

Area of Science:

  • Psychology
  • Neuroscience
  • Pain Research

Background:

  • Anxiety is often considered a significant factor influencing pain perception.
  • The role of attentional focus in modulating pain responses requires further investigation.

Purpose of the Study:

  • To investigate whether attentional focus or anxiety levels have a greater influence on pain perception.
  • To differentiate the effects of directing attention towards or away from a pain stimulus under varying anxiety conditions.

Main Methods:

  • A within-subject design was employed with 24 participants diagnosed with spider phobia.
  • Participants received electrical stimulation under four conditions: low/high anxiety combined with attention directed towards or away from the pain.
  • Anxiety was induced via spider exposure; subjective pain ratings and Skin Conductance Responses (SCR) were measured.

Main Results:

  • Subjective pain ratings were consistently lower when attention was directed away from the pain stimulus, irrespective of anxiety level.
  • Initial Skin Conductance Responses (SCR) were higher when attention was distracted from pain compared to attending to it.
  • No significant influence of anxiety on subjective pain ratings or Skin Conductance Responses (SCR) was observed.

Conclusions:

  • Attentional focus, rather than anxiety itself, appears to be the primary modulator of pain perception.
  • Directing attention away from painful stimuli can effectively reduce subjective pain intensity.
  • These findings have implications for non-pharmacological pain management strategies, particularly for phobic individuals.
